When should I stay at a B&B in Almonte?
When you're dreaming of a getaway to Almonte, year-round temperatures and rainfall may be important factors to consider.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 65°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 21°F. The snowiest months in Almonte are January, December, February, and November, with each month seeing an average of 10 inches of snowfall.

How can I get to and around Almonte?
Planning your excursions in and around Almonte is easier with these transportation options. Fly into Ottawa International Airport (YOW), which is located 26.5 mi (42.6 km) away from the heart of the city. If you'd like to venture out around the area, consider renting a car to take in more sights.
